Output e4fe4a0784e4478fd3532de99fb65e126ef43f2bc86724dc6657a797606fe629:6

value
5809228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64768fe55079fed461c7cd6ec4a61daa8efc7c2a OP_EQUAL
address
3ArDXZkLWLC6bkZsXyxfamdvXzgzqa8nQD
transaction
e4fe4a0784e4478fd3532de99fb65e126ef43f2bc86724dc6657a797606fe629
spent
true